Position Overview:


The Language Video-Telephone- Interpreter is responsible for handling calls on demand and renders the meaning of conversations between Hmong and English speakers. The interpreter breaks the communication barrier in various industries: Healthcare, Insurance, Financial, General Business, and 911. The interpreter processes information quickly and concisely and recognizes sensitive cultural differences. The interpreter is professional and courteous and uses appropriate, terminology and understands standard industry procedures and practices. The video and audio interpreting sessions may involve simple or complex, technical, or non-technical subjects. However, this position does not involve written translation; translators and other skilled linguists are encouraged to apply. The interpreters translate verbally.





This is a remote position. The Interpreter works from his/her home office. It is essential to ensure a quiet & secure environment. **





Essential Job Functions



  • Respond to video and audio interpreting sessions promptly and conduct interpretation in a friendly and professional manner.

  • Participate in online, video and audio training sessions.

  • Deliver interpretation services via video and expediently type data on a company-provided device, such as a laptop, to perform the job’s essential functions.

  • Render correct concepts and meanings according to the conventions of established interpretation protocol, avoiding omissions or additions.

  • Speak clearly in both languages using proper pronunciation, enunciation, and polite expressions.

  • Maintain a professional demeanor throughout the video and audio interpreting sessions.

  • Remain calm during video and audio interpreting sessions if one of the speakers is incoherent or upset, especially in emergencies such as 911 calls.

  • Maintain punctuality and availability during scheduled work hours.

  • Follow client instructions in compliance with protocol to ensure client expectations are met with the Limited English-speaking Person (LEP), avoiding interaction with the LEP without the client’s permission.

  • Understand protocol and terminology for various industries including, but not limited to, Medical, Insurance, Finance and Law.

  • Demonstrate commitment to cultural sensitivity and working in a diverse environment.

Technical Requirements:



  • High-speeded Internet connection for work-related electronic communication. This internet connection should provide download speeds of no less than 5 Mbps and upload speeds of 3 Mbps.

  • Your home office should provide space for a backdrop of 5 ft by 7 ft and a desk and chair. 

  • A direct connection from the modem to the desktop or laptop must be used. Cable or fiber optic services are preferred. For optimal connectivity: Satellite service is not permissible.

  • Must have access to a quiet space free from background noise or distraction.



Physical Requirements:



  • Must be able to operate a keyboard and mouse and remain in a stationary position in front of a computer and webcam for most of the workday.

  • Must use a headset for prolonged periods. Must be able to operate company-provided software and systems to perform all aspects of the job.

  • Must have sufficient manual dexterity to type or write.

  • May be exposed to moderate noise levels, i.e., computer, audio, telephone.
